    Summary: polkit security update

    Details: polkit is a toolkit for defining and handling authorizations. It is used for allowing unprivileged processes to speak to privileged processes. Security Fix(es): A flaw was found in polkit. When a requesting process disconnects from dbus-daemon just before the call to polkit_system_bus_name_get_creds_sync starts, the process cannot get a unique uid and pid of the process and it cannot verify the privileges of the requesting process. The highest threat from this vulnerability is to data confidentiality and integrity as well as system availability.(CVE-2021-3560)
